RELATIONSHIP TO INCENTIVES AND REGULATIONS?
Can combine certification with an easement, HCP or cost-share program.
Must meet minimum state regulations to be certified, but landowners not exempt from ESA. Safe harbor agreements help to mitigate.
Notes:
Land owners must meet or exceed all governmental regulations when seeking to become certified. However, because conservation easement, HCP, cost-share and certification programs produce overlapping benefits, land owners may wish to combine programs with one another. This should produce greater combined benefits for the land owner -- especially if the costs are not too large. Land owners should also investigate safe harbor agreements available to them if they engage in selected conservation programs.
